Are people in Dickinson older or younger than people in Houston?- The Median Age in Dickinson is 2.4 years older than in Houston.
Are housing costs cheaper in Dickinson or Houston?- Dickinson
housing costs are 3.5% more expensive than Houston hous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Dickinson or Houston?- The average commute for residents of Dickinson is 2.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Houston.
